In this paper, the object of our investigation is the following Littlewood-Paley square function g associated with the Schrödinger operator L=-Δ+V which is defined by: g(f)(x)=(∫0∞|(d)/(dt)e-tL(f)(x)|2tdt)1/2, where Δ is the laplacian operator on ℝn and V is a nonnegative potential.
